Runeterra Card modifications

Champions
Seven champions obtained some tweaks and modifications, starting from the minor ones like Garen’s nerfed assault and well being, to the most important reworks like Lux’s means. These champions see a bit extra play in Expeditions than the constructed deck Ranked modes, so it’s extremely doubtless that these modifications shall be sticking round for some time. Make positive to have a look at our Legends of Runeterra best decks information to see if any of those champions make it into the decks you ought to be making.
- Lux: Base kind stats modified from 5/Three to three/4.
- Lux: Base kind stage up situation modified to: “I’ve seen you cast 6+ mana of spells. Then create a Fleeting Final Spark in hand.”
- Lux: Level up kind stats modified from 6/Four to 4/5.
- Lux: Level up means modified to: “When I’ve seen you spend 6+ mana on spells, create a Fleeting Final Spark in hand.”
- Lux: Final spark modified to a zero mana spell that has “Deal 4 damage to an enemy unit. Fleeting.”
- Garen: Base kind stats modified from 6/6 to five/5.
- Garen: Level up kind stats modified from 7/7 to six/6.
- Draven: Base kind stats modified from 4/Three to three/3.
- Draven: Level up kind stats modified from 5/Four to 4/4.
- Shen: Base kind stats modified from 2/6 to 2/5.
- Shen: Level up kind stats modified from 3/7 to three/6.
- Thresh: Base kind stats modified from 3/5 to three/6.
- Thresh: Level up situation modified to “I’ve seen 6+ units die.”
- Thresh: Level up kind stats modified from 4/6 to 4/7.
- Thresh: Level up means modified to “The first time I attack this game, summon an attacking champion from your deck or hand.”
- Thresh: Thresh’s The Box modified to a Fast spell that reads “Deal 3 damage to each enemy that was summoned this round. Shuffle a Thresh into the deck.”
- Kalista: Base kind positive aspects Fearsome key phrase and the play means now says “Play: I bond with an ally. Grant it +2/+0 while we are bonded.”
- Kalista: Level up kind positive aspects Fearsome key phrase the play means now says “Play: I bond with an ally. Grant it +2/+0 while we are bonded.”
- Elise: Elise positive aspects Spider unit sort and stage up situation now says: “Start of Round: You have 3+ other spiders.”

Followers & spells
A number of followers and spells from many areas noticed some tweaks. Some followers and spells had minimal affect on the game, whereas others simply did a bit an excessive amount of. The major playing cards to look out for are Grasp of the Undying and Detain being a lot extra playable now, whereas playing cards like Precious Pet and Corina Verazza being closely hampered. Below is an inventory of all of the modifications.
- Tianna Crownguard: Mana price elevated from 7 to eight.
- Detain: Mana price lowered from 6 to five.
- Mageseeker Investigator: Mana price elevated from 2 to three. Play means now reads: “If you cast a spell this round, remove all text and keywords from an enemy follower.”
- Mobilize: Mana price elevated from 2 to three.
- Basilisk Rider: Attack energy elevated from Four to five.
- Intimidating Roar: Spell modified from Fast velocity to Slow velocity.
- Precious Pet: Loses its means and as a substitute positive aspects Fearsome key phrase.
- Reckoning: Mana price elevated from 5 to six.
- She Who Wanders: Mana price elevated from 9 to 10.
- Balesight: Skill now reads “Obliterate all followers with 4 or less power in play and in hands.”
- Avalanche: Spell now says “Deal 2 damage to all units.”
- Heart of the Fluft: Mana price elevated from 5 to six.
- Wyrding Stones: Mana price elevated from 2 to three.
- Scarmaiden Reaver: Health lowered from 6 to five.
- Navori Bladescout: Ability now reads “When I’m summoned, give me Elusive this round.”
- Sown Seeds: Mana price lowered from Three to 2. Ability now reads “Grants allies in hand +1/+0”
- Corina Verazza: Mana price elevated from eight to 9. Attack and well being lowered from 7/7 to six/6.
- Assembly Bot: Attack and well being lowered from 2/2 to 1/1. Ability now reads “When you cast a spell, grant me +1/+1.”
- Augmented Experimenter: Play means now reads “Discard your hand. Draw 3. Deal 3 to an enemy unit.”
- Chempunk Shredder: Play means now reads: “Deal 1 damage to all enemy units.”
- Eager Apprentice: When summoned it now refills 2 spell mana slightly than all spell mana.
- Flame Chompers!: Health lowered from Three to 1.
- Flash of Brilliance: Mana price lowered from 6 to three. Ability now reads “Create a random spell in hand. Refill your spell mana.”
- Rising Spell Force: Ability now reads “Give an ally +4/+0 and Quick Attack this round.”
- Absorb Soul: Spell velocity modified from Burst to Fast.
- Glimpse Beyond: Spell velocity modified from Burst to Fast.
- Grasp of the Undying: Spell now says “Drain 3 health from a unit.”
- The Box: Spell velocity modified from Burst to Fast. Spell now reads “Deal 3 damage to each enemy that was summoned this round.”
- Warden’s Prey: Last Breath means now reads: “Create in hand another Last Breath follower from any region that costs 3 mana or less.”
- Withering Wail: Ability now reads “Deal 1 damage to all enemy units. Heal your Nexus 3 health.”
- Brood Awakening: Mana price elevated from 5 to six.

Miscellaneous modifications and bugfixes
Finally, listed below are all of the bugfixes which were carried out within the preview beta patch notes:
- Clicking on both participant’s deck in-game now additionally reveals any champions included within the deck (along with the deck’s areas). In a future patch, they plan to enhance this characteristic additional by asserting champions at game begin, so gamers don’t want to examine decks each match.
- The AI was exhibiting a bit an excessive amount of disrespect–it ought to now extra usually block apparent deadly injury, and never play spells for no profit (like therapeutic a full well being unit).
- Player nameplates shrunk, and not seen throughout champ stage ups.
- Discarded playing cards added to Action Log.
- Fixed a problem the place gamers would sometimes get right into a bugged state and obtain a brand new quest on each login.
- Fixed a problem stopping the Vault from progressing previous Level 9 for some gamers.
- Fixed problem the place Vault development would generally not show appropriately on the end-of-game display.
- While it was flavorful, Ruination will not sometimes crash the game.
- Surrendering a tutorial with an open immediate will not crash the game.
- Overwhelm injury will not sometimes crash the game.
- Quickly casting a bunch of Burst spells will not crash the game.
- Opponent’s revealed playing cards will not flicker.
- Playing Warden’s Prey whereas Spider Queen Elise is in play will not mute all VO.
- Eggnivia rework results will now play correctly.
- The board will not sometimes flip blue when Ashe ranges up.
- You’ll not generally be matched in opposition to the mysterious “_” (opponent’s names generally displayed that approach throughout matches).
- Nexus explosions will not sometimes throw the game digicam off-kilter.
- Hovered playing cards in deckbuilder ought to not sometimes get caught on the display.
- Fixed a problem inflicting service notifications to generally not be seen.
- Various stability enhancements.
